Panasonic Arc5 Palm-Sized Electric Razor
Staying well-groomed on your travels has never been easier thanks to this tiny electric razor from Panasonic, which fits in the palm of a hand. It packs 50 minutes of shave time into one charge, so you might not even need to pack the charger on most trips. Plus, the five stainless-steel blades provide a close, comfortable shave, with a built-in bed sensor adjusting the pressure according to the contours of your face. From $269.99.

Pluto Pod 2.o Travel Pillow
Getting some rest on a long journey can be a real challenge, particularly given the poor design of many travel pillows. The POD 2.0 aims to fix that with a structured hood that allows you to comfortably lean your head against a window as well as provide support for the neck and chin. Combined with a built-in eye mask, you’ll be nodding off in no time, and its lightweight, compact design makes it easy to pack. $145.

Bril UV-C Toothbrush Sanitizer
Traveling abroad can expose us to different microbes than our bodies are used to, sometimes with unpleasant results. Reduce your risk of a vacation illness by using this toothbrush sanitizer, which uses UV light to kill up to 99.9 percent of germs. Featuring a magnet to easily attach to the bathroom mirror or any other magnetic surface, it fits any kind of toothbrush. The Bril is available in three colors and recharges using a supplied USB cable, although it will last a whole month on one charge. $29.99.
